Lithium-ion roj teeb vs. Lead-acid roj teeb: Dab tsi yog qhov txawv?

Apr 14, 2023Tso lus

Cov roj teeb yog ib qho tseem ceeb ntawm ntau yam khoom siv thiab cov tshuab, siv txhua yam los ntawm lub tsheb thiab smartphones mus rau hnub ci vaj huam sib luag thiab khoom siv kho mob. Ob hom roj teeb uas siv ntau tshaj plaws yog lithium-ion (Li-ion) thiab cov roj teeb lead-acid. Nov yog qee qhov sib txawv tseem ceeb ntawm ob:

1. Cov khoom siv hluav taws xob

Lead-acid roj teebsiv cov phaj ua los ntawm txhuas thiab txhuas oxide, thaum Li-ion roj teeb siv graphite (carbon) anodes thiab hlau oxide cathodes xws li lithium cobalt oxide (LiCoO2) los yog lithium hlau phosphate (LiFePO4). Li-ion roj teeb kuj muaj lithium electrolytes, uas pab txhawb ion ntws ntawm cathode thiab anode.

 

2. Roj teeb muaj peev xwm

Li-ion roj teebFeem ntau muaj lub zog ceev dua li cov roj ntsha lead-acid, txhais tau tias lawv tuaj yeem khaws ntau lub zog hauv qhov chaw me me. Qhov no ua rau lawv zoo tagnrho rau cov khoom siv txawb thiab nqa tau yooj yim uas xav tau lub zog tso zis ntau, xws li smartphones thiab laptops. Lead-acid roj teeb, ntawm qhov tod tes, zoo dua rau cov ntawv thov uas lub roj teeb tsis tas yuav tsum yog lub teeb yuag lossis compact, xws li cov khoom siv hluav taws xob rov qab rau cov tsev lossis cov chaw khaws ntaub ntawv.

 

3. Roj teeb nyhav

Li-ion roj teeb feem ntau sib dua li cov roj teeb txhuas-acid, uas ua rau lawv yooj yim dua rau kev siv mobile. Vim tias cov roj ntsha lead-acid yog ua los ntawm cov hlau hnyav, lawv yuav hnyav dua.

 

4. Them nqi thiab tso tawm voj voog

Li-ion roj teeb muaj lub neej ntev dua li cov roj ntsha lead-acid, uas txhais tau hais tias lawv tuaj yeem rov ua dua thiab tawm ntau zaus. Qhov nruab nrab Li-ion roj teeb tuaj yeem nyob nruab nrab ntawm 500 thiab 1,500 lub voj voog, thaum lub roj teeb txhuas-acid feem ntau kav li ntawm 300 thiab 700 mus.

5. Nqe

Cov roj teeb li-ion feem ntau kim dua li cov roj ntsha lead-acid, tshwj xeeb tshaj yog rau cov roj teeb loj lossis muaj peev xwm loj. Txawm li cas los xij, tus nqi sib txawv yog maj mam ploj mus vim Li-ion thev naus laus zis tau txais ntau dua thiab cov nqi tsim khoom txo qis.

 

6. Lub neej ntev

Lub roj teeb lub neej nyob ntawm ntau yam, suav nrog kev siv, kev them nqi thiab kev tso tawm, thiab kev cia khoom. Qhov nruab nrab, cov roj ntsha lead-acid kav ntev li ob mus rau peb xyoos, thaum cov roj teeb lithium tuaj yeem siv tau tsib xyoos lossis ntau dua.

 

7. Kev ceev faj txog kev nyab xeeb

Ob lub Li-ion thiab lead-acid roj teeb tuaj yeem ua rau muaj kev phom sij yog tias tsis ua haujlwm zoo. Li-ion roj teeb muaj qhov ua rau o, overheating, thiab tawg ruptures yog tias lawv overcharged, lub cev puas tsuaj los yog raug kub. Lead-acid roj teeb tuaj yeem xau cov kua qaub thiab tsim cov pa roj lom yog tias overcharged lossis puas. Kev tuav kom zoo, kev teeb tsa, kev saib xyuas, thiab kev pov tseg yog qhov tseem ceeb rau ob hom roj teeb kom muaj kev nyab xeeb.

8. Tus nqi rov ua dua

Ob lub Li-ion thiab lead-acid roj teeb tuaj yeem rov ua dua thaum lawv mus txog qhov kawg ntawm lawv lub neej muaj txiaj ntsig. Li-ion roj teeb muaj cov hlau tseem ceeb xws li cobalt, npib tsib xee, thiab lithium, uas tuaj yeem muab rho tawm thiab rov siv dua hauv cov roj teeb tshiab lossis lwm yam khoom. Lead-acid roj teeb kuj tseem tuaj yeem rov ua dua tshiab, nrog cov hmoov txhuas siv los ua cov roj teeb tshiab lossis lwm yam khoom siv lead ua.

 

Nyob rau hauv xaus, Li-ion roj teeb thiab lead-acid roj teeb yog ob qho tib si tseem ceeb thiab dav siv lub zog cia daws teeb meem, nrog rau lawv tus kheej lub zog thiab tsis muaj zog. Thaum xaiv ntawm ob, nws yog ib qho tseem ceeb uas yuav tau xav txog tej yam xws li lub zog muaj peev xwm, qhov hnyav, tus nqi, kev nyab xeeb, thiab kev xaiv rov ua dua tshiab.
